Within our recently established (4 years ago) and rapidly growing office in Belgium we are looking for a QHSE Manager M/F for our office in Zeebrugge.
As a QHSE Manager M/F, you will lead and manage all QHSE related matters, provide expertise the site team, management and to the overall Quality Management System, develop and apply policies and standards to support proper and smooth execution of all QHSE related activities in meeting the specified standards and requirements in line with company policies.
You will assist the site team to ensure that all contractual deliverables are in line with expectations by supporting them with the production and follow up of the deliverables.
Your main tasks and responsibilities include:
- To support the management in all QHSE related matters.
- To implement, review and follow up on relevant HSE procedures.
- To review and update on changes in legislation related to HSE.
- To support and follow up on the site team in applying QHSE.
- Participate in accident investigation.
- Perform and support safety audits.
- To implement preventive measures and corrective actions for non-conforming products.
- Able to demonstrate implementation, documentation & monitoring experience in the development & application of ISO standards (9001- 14001), AQAP.
- Review, comment and approve the contractors Quality Control Plans.
- Manage project audit program.
- Prepare and implement the project Quality and inspection strategy to cover all project phases.
- The ability to identify and intervene in problem areas.
- Good knowledge and hands-on experience in External & Internal Quality Audit Program.
- Good analytical skills and experience with quality tools and methodologies
- Ensuring that the verification presentation file is created and updated for verification operations, and that all the elements are in place for presentation to the customer for acceptance.
